This is an excellent opportunity to leverage your experience and skills at the intersection of data science, AI, and cloud technologies.What You'll Do:
- Design, document, and maintain cloud-native and hybrid reference architectures showcasing Anaconda's integration with leading platforms, with an emphasis on AI/ML workloads
- Create reusable templates and deployment guides for scalable AI pipelines across AWS Sagemaker, Azure Machine Learning, Google Vertex AI, Databricks ML, and NVIDIA AI Enterprise
- Guide customers in architecting modern AI/ML platforms combining Anaconda's capabilities with:
- AWS: SageMaker, Bedrock, EC2 with GPU, EKS
- Azure: Machine Learning, OpenAI Service, AKS
- GCP: Vertex AI, AI Platform, Deep Learning VMs
- NVIDIA: Triton Inference Server, NGC containers, CUDA/XLA
- Databricks: MLflow, Unity Catalog, Feature Store
- Snowflake: AI/ML across Snowpark, Snowflake container services, Cortex
- Drive joint solution development with partners to showcase performant, secure, and production-ready AI/ML architectures
- Work with Product and Engineering teams to align roadmaps with customer and partner needs
- Collaborate with AWS, Azure, Google, NVIDIA, and Databricks technical teams on joint architectures and validation content
- Produce technical whitepapers, blogs, and best practices content
- Present at webinars, partner events, and conferences
- Serve as a trusted advisor in the pre-sales process, guiding architectural decisions and assisting with proof-of-concepts
- 5+ years in a solution architecture, ML engineering, or technical consulting role focused on AI/ML
- Proven experience deploying AI/ML workloads on AWS, Azure, and/or GCP
- Hands-on experience with GPU acceleration technologies (NVIDIA CUDA, RAPIDS, Triton Inference Server)
- Experience with Databricks ML and managing pipelines using MLflow or Delta Lake
- Strong understanding of MLOps practices, including CI/CD, model governance, and reproducibility
- Excellent communication skills for technical and non-technical audiences
- Strong cross-functional collaboration skills
